TAKING PICTURE OR VIDEO TECHNIQUE


There are several techniques for taking pictures or video, the following techniques are often used:

1.  [CAMERA ANGLE].
a.Bird Eye View.
Shooting is done from the top at a certain height so that shows that such a vast environment with other objects that appear at the bottom so small.
Taking pictures in this way is usually by helicopter or from tall buildings.
If you like to watch Hollywood movies, of course, these techniques are familiar to you.

b.High Angle.
Filming technique with angle shooting right above the object, taking pictures like this have the sense of the dramatic that is small or dwarf.

c.Low Angle
This technique of shooting that took the picture from the bottom of the object, the angle of this picture is the opposite of the high angle.
Impression that caused the keagungngan or glory.
Usually this technique is often used to create a monster or a giant human karakater.

d.Eye Level
Taking pictures with a point of view of the object at eye level, there is no specific dramatic impression in the can from eye level, which exists only memperlihatkna eye view of a person standing.

e.Frog Level.
This angle is taken parallel to the surface of the object becomes very large.

FIGURE 2. [FRAME SIZE]

a.Extreem Close-up [ECU].
Taking pictures is very close, only show certain parts of the body object.
Function for the details for an object.

b.Big Cloe-up [BCU].
Taking pictures is only limited to the head to the chin of the object.
Function to highlight the expression of which is issued by the object.

c.Close-up [CU].
Picture size only to the extent of head to neck.
Its function is to give a clear picture of the object neighbor.

d.Medium Close-up [MCU].
Limited to images taken from head to chest.
Its function is to reinforce the profile of someone that the audience is clear.

e.Mid Shoot [MS].
The extent of shooting the head to the waist.
Function clearly shows the figure of the object.

f.Kneel Shoot [KS].
Limited to head shots to the knee.
Funsinya almost the same as the Mid Shoot.

g. Full Shoot [FS]
Full shots from head to toe.
Memeperlihatkan function object and its environment.

h.Long Shoot [LS]
Wider shots of the Fool Shoot.
To mnujukan object with the background.

i.Extreem Long Shoot [ELS].
Exceed the long shots Shoot, featuring environments of the object as a whole.
To indicate the object is part of the environment.

Shoot j.1.
Taking pictures of the object.
Its function is to show a person or object in the frame.

K.2 Shoot.
2 shooting objects
For the second scene shows people who are communicating.

l.3.Shoot
3 shots of objects to show 3 people who were talking.

m.Group Shoot
Shooting set of objects
To show scenes of a group of people in the activity.


3. [MOVING CAMERA]

a.Zooming [In / out]
Movements by the camera lens closer or away from the object, this movement is a facility provided by the vidio camera, and the cameraman just to operate it.

b.Panning [Left / Right].
The mean motion in panning the camera moves from the middle to the right or left of center, but not the camera tripod that moves but the moves in the direction desired.

c.Tilting [Up / Down].
Tilting yitu movement up and down movement, still use the tripod as a tool to get the image on satisfactory and stable.

d.Dolly [In / Out].
Movement in doing the movement back and forth, almost the same as the movement Zooming but Dolly is moving tripod that has been given a wheel by pushing forward or pulling it backward tripod.

e.Follow.
Filming is done by following a moving object in the same direction.

f.Framing [In / Out].
Framing is done by movement of the object to enter the [in] or out [out] framing the shot.

g.Fading [In / Out].
An image change slowly.
When new images replace existing images entered in the call fade in, whereas if the existing image slowly disappeared and was replaced in the new images called fade out.

h.Crane Shoot.
Is the camera movement is mounted on the tool of self-propelled wheeled machine and the same cameraman, both near and away from the object.

4. [OBJECT MOVING]

a.Kamera parallel object.
Parallel to the camera follows the movement of objects, both left and to right

b.Walking [In / Out]
moving object approaching [in] and stay away from [out] the camera.
